Kerr and Steinberg were more or less saying the coaching is to blame and has to take the brunt of the blame. Wills said he doesnt know of a coach in the NHL past or present who could win with a top line, top d-pairing and starting goalie strugging this hard. Said things like 'is Glen the one giving away odd man rushes at the blue line', etc.
It sounded a lot like the discussions we have on here. Kerr basically ended up asking when it is time to panic, how long we can go on like this before things start getting really bad. Also made the chicken and the egg analogy asking if the players have been bad because of the coaching, or the coaching has looked bad because of the players. I was really surprised to hear some of the things they said, not because
I disagree or they were alarmist but because the Fan 960 is usually very homer-ish and easy on the coaching/management.
I kind of feel bad for GG. I really dont think ALL of this is his fault at all. That is really harsh imo. We've had some shocking performances from our highest paid, go to players. At the end of the day, even if he is in over his head (who knows this early) - that's going to be on management for hiring him.
He is an easy scapegoat. Not that his 'system' and some of the decisions he's made arent questionable, but its not fair to solely blame him for our terrible play. This is coming from someone who has been really critical of the coaching. I think it is ridiculous to blame him for all of it and purpose firing him.

PP and PK can be blamed on the coaching staff. And even then it's not on the coaching staff that the team has taken the most minor penalties in the NHL so far.
The 5v5 struggles come down to the players IMO.
Too many bad decisions with the puck, too many times the d-men have let guys get behind them or a forward didn't cover the point. Those mistakes have nothing to do with systems and are issues that we have seen too many times early in this season.
Top that all of with the fact that out "best" players have looked horrible and disinterested so far this season and it's a bit of a perfect storm.
